How do you fix a crumbling concrete driveway?

Mix one part Type 1 Portland cement and one part fine sand by volume. Add water until the mixture is the consistency of thick paint, then brush it on the damp concrete.

Can you resurface a cracked concrete driveway?

Concrete resurfacing to cover larger cracks or surface problems. Large cracks or holes greater than ¼”, spalling (horizontal peeling or chipping of the surface), and discoloration can be covered with resurfacing or a concrete overlay (a thin layer of cement-based material applied directly over the existing concrete).

What can I put on crumbling concrete?

Rub the bristles of a stiff scrub brush over the edges of the crumbling area to remove loose concrete and dirt. Apply a thin coat of concrete bonding agent over each of the crumbling areas, using a medium to large paintbrush. Apply a layer of prepared concrete 3/8 inch thick with a pointed metal trowel.

Can you pour over old concrete?

You can put new concrete over old concrete. However, unresolved issues with your old concrete, such as cracks or frost heaves, will carry over to your new concrete if not taken care of. In addition, you must pour it at least 2 inches thick.

What is a concrete bonding agent?

Concrete bonding agents are natural or synthetic materials used to join the old and new concrete surfaces. This agent can also be used to join the successive concrete layers. This chemical helps to allow different concrete surfaces to behave like a single unit.

Whats the difference between cement and concrete?

What is the difference between cement and concrete? Although the terms cement and concrete often are used interchangeably, cement is actually an ingredient of concrete. Concrete is a mixture of aggregates and paste. Cement comprises from 10 to 15 percent of the concrete mix, by volume.

Can I patch concrete with quikrete?

QUIKRETE® Concrete Patching Compound (No. 8650-35) is a ready-to-use, trowel applied acrylic latex formulation for making repairs to cracks, holes and breaks up to 1/4″ deep in concrete, stucco or masonry walls, sidewalks, patios, driveways, etc.
